CN I goes through?
Cribriform Plate
CN II goes through
Optic Canal
The second branch of the Trigeminal Nerve (V2) goes through?
Foramen rotundum as well as the inferior orbital fissure, groove, and canal before exiting the infra orbital foramen
What goes through the superior orbital fissure?
CN III, CN IV, CN VI, CN V1
The third branch of the Trigeminal Nerve (V3) goes through?
Foramen Ovale
The middle meningeal artery goes through?
Foramen Spinosum
The internal carotid artery goes through?
Carotid Canal
What two nerves go through the internal acoustic meatus?
CN VII and CN VIII
Where does CN VII exit?
at the stylomastoid foramen to innervate the face
What nerves go through the jugular canal?
CN IX, CN X , and CN XI
CN XII goes through what?
Hypoglossal Canal
Emissary veins go through which openings?
Foramen Cecum, Parietal foramen, and the condylar canal
The mental nerve is a branch of which nerve?
Mandibular Nerve V3 (third part of Trigeminal Nerve)
What goes through the mental foramen in the mandible?
Mental Nerve (branch of V3), artery, and Vein
What goes through the mandibular foramen?
Inferior Alveolar v/n/a
What goes through the greater palatine foramen?
Greater palatine n/a/v
What goes through the lesser palatine foramen?
Lesser Palatine n/a/v
Foramen ovale goes to the ?
infra temporal fossa
The foramen rotundum goes to the?
pterygopalatine fossa
What runs in the pterion?
Middle meningeal artery
